What is there to do in Northern New Mexico near my business-friendly hotel?
There are so many ways to fill your downtime in Northern New Mexico. If you're visiting Albuquerque, explore ABQ BioPark Zoo, ABQ BioPark Aquarium and Indian Pueblo Cultural Center. Packing your cases for Santa Fe? Georgia O'Keefe Museum, Cathedral Basilica of Saint Francis of Assisi and Palace of the Governors are some of the best sights in this city.
